How GreenLeaf Property Cut Admin Hours in Half with Workflow Automation
Property Management | 22 employees | 8-week project
Manual Everything — Emails, Reminders, Maintenance, Chasing Payments
GreenLeaf Property is a 22-person team managing 180+ residential units. Every rent reminder was a manual email. Maintenance requests arrived via text message and were tracked in a notes app on the property manager's phone. Lease renewal dates lived in a spreadsheet nobody checked consistently.
The property manager estimated 20+ hours per week consumed by pure administrative follow-up — chasing late payments, updating maintenance statuses, and manually sending reminders that should have been automatic. The team was reactive, not proactive, because they had no system to get ahead of issues.
- Rent reminders sent manually per tenant each month — error-prone and time-consuming
- Maintenance requests lost or delayed due to no central tracking system
- Lease renewal dates missed because they lived in an unmonitored spreadsheet
- No way to see portfolio health at a glance — no dashboard, no alerts
n8n Automation + Airtable as the Central Operating System
AutoOps built an n8n automation layer connected to Airtable as the single source of truth for the entire portfolio. Automated rent reminder sequences fire 5 days before and on the due date for each tenant — no manual action required. A maintenance request form feeds a ticketing workflow that assigns requests to vendors, tracks resolution status, and closes tickets automatically on completion.
We built a lease expiry dashboard in Airtable with automated 90/60/30-day renewal nudges sent directly to tenants. A nightly summary dashboard gives the team an at-a-glance view of occupancy, overdue rent, and open maintenance tickets — replacing the morning routine of checking three different apps and a spreadsheet.

Fewer Fires, More Breathing Room
Weekly administrative hours dropped from 20+ to under 10 within the first month. The team no longer started each week in reactive mode — the automation handled the routine follow-up, freeing staff to focus on tenant relationships and property issues that actually required human judgment.
On-time rent payment rates climbed from roughly 65% to 90% as tenants consistently received reminders before due dates rather than late notices after. The property manager described it as "the first time I've felt in control of the portfolio in years" — a sentiment reflected in the numbers: zero missed lease renewal conversations in the first quarter post-launch.
